Naval Fleet Introduction and Logistics Support Analyst
The Opportunity:

From both a personnel and systems perspective, the U.S. Navy is growing fast. As a product support and fleet introduction analyst, you'll play an integral role in the strategic planning and execution work required to provide our Navy clients with big picture ideas rooted in technical and data-driven solutions that will help to propel them into the future and ensure military and maritime dominance. You be part of a dynamic team across multiple geographies and workstreams, with projects that involve analytical solutions for the implementation of modernization and logistics plans that affect the production, distribution, and inventory of finished products to enhance product flow and improve use while delivering end-to-end integrated warfighting capabilities.

You will support various aspects of ship implementation teams for new capability on Naval vessels and expeditionary units. Collaborate with DoD Joint Services to integrate capability ships and expeditionary forces enabling the fleet introduction, initial operational capability, and logistics sustainment of these capabilities. Participate in Design Reviews, Technical Readiness Reviews, and Production Readiness Reviews necessary to deliver a system. Support shipboard production and fielding planning, including the implementation of ship change documents (SCDs), Interface Control Documents (ICDs) and alterations; coordinate with public and private shipyards, system fielding and testing, and establish life cycle sustainment support plans, including assessment of staffing and material support requirements.

Based out of the Washington Navy Yard, you have a direct finger on the pulse of the policies, guidelines, and procedures required to ensure quality and cost control across a Navy major program office.

You have:
  • 8+ years of experience with program, operations, and logistics management
  • Experience with using Microsoft Office products
  • Experience with ILS Certification
  • Experience with ship alterations including on CVN or large deck platforms
  • Experience with NDE, CDMD-OA, CMPRO, and EMASS
  • Top Secret clearance
  • HS diploma or GED

Nice to have:
  • 5+ years of experience with serving in or supporting the U.S. Navy
  • Experience with product support manager functions, including acquisition support, supply support and outfitting, maintenance and readiness support, life cycle solutions, Reliability, Availability, and Maintainability (RAM) program management and analysis, and Human Systems Integration (HSI) analysis or training
  • Experience with program management of major ACAT programs
  • Experience with the PPBE cycle
  • Experience with authoring and supporting logistics documents to support program milestones, including lifecycle sustainment plan, maintenance plan, and training plans
  • Experience with the Navy Modernization Process (NMP)
  • Possession of exc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Bachelor's degree
